摘要
China's continental oil and gas geological theory occupies an important academic position in the world's academic circle of petroleum geology. China's oil and gas resources are dominated by continental resources. Chinese geologists have successfully explored and developed complex continental oil and gas, and developed a continental oil and gas geological theory system. This paper summarizes the development history and theoretical achievements of continental oil and gas geological theory since the 1940s and proposes that the development of this theory should be divided into three stages (i.e., proposal, formation and development). The China's continental oil and gas geological theory has formed a basically perfect theoretical system consisting of five parts, i.e., continental basin structure theory, continental basin sediments and reservoirs theory, continental oil generation theory, continental oil and gas accumulation theory, and continental sandstone oil and gas field development geology. As an advanced geological theory, it has a universal significance globally. This paper focuses on the major discoveries of oil and gas exploration and development and the production growth in the basins of the Central and Western China in the past 30 years as well as the major advances in the continental oil and gas geological theory, including the continental basin tectonics of Central and Western China under the compression background, special reservoir geology such as various types of lake basin sedimentary systems and deep conglomerate, new fields of continental hydrocarbon generation such as coal-generated hydrocarbons, continental oil and gas enrichment regularity such as foreland thrust belts and lithologic-stratigraphic reservoirs, continental unconventional oil and gas geology and continental low-permeability oil and gas development geology. These major advances have greatly developed and enriched the continental oil and gas geological theory and become an important part of it.
